Spain won 3-2. Iniesta+fabx2. uzary..atm..that's what I'm felt. Pep might have an intention to develop a whole team of midfielder with or without 'true' CB. Or pep might use onli 1 true CB to cover up GK and let other 9 player with midfielder ability or attacking minded to control the game/pitch. I tried to figure out the reason why pep such reluctant to buy another experienced CB, instead always opted masch and busquet to play on CB whenever puyol or pique or both injured. As traditional formation, back four or three are very important regardless the formation 442 or 433 or 4231 and whatsoever. And at the installation of fab and rising thiago. And at the same time also, sold oriol romeu with buy back clause, and secure rising sergi roberto with clause 20M. At first I tought fab will be the replacement for xavi, but it seems not. Slowly and gradually, pep mix and let them play togather. I'm not surprise in next 3-4 years, such attacking minded fullback will slowly fade to let their posisiton fill up by these midfielders. In other word, pep want to transform pitch as one big training center with the ball pass around wide. We might see thiago at defense and and fab at opponents goal post. Ok, we have fontas and montoya. Yet again, I'm not surprise if pep installed them with attacking minded to marauding forward and let only one or no one to cover our GK. As la masia student, fontas, montoya and others understand the game..and pep will teach them more. Its like gradute with SPM in la masia, and now further study under pep to have a diploma. Its just my theory. I dunno..just to justifiy with myself the reason why pep not eager to find at least another 1 experienced CB. That's why I'm just keep quiet..because while he analyze game, we also analyze him. Hurm..the 'we are defender who attack, we are attacker who defend' mantra, from day to day..it makes sense. Perhaps it is the real Total Football that pep craving utmost. At least for me la. Hehe. Anyway, it just my opinion.
